57624 is a even composite number that follows 57623 and precedes 57625. It is composed of 40 distinct factors: 1, 2, 3, 4, 6, 7, 8, 12, 14, 21, 24, 28, 42, 49, 56, 84, 98, 147, 168, 196, 294, 343, 392, 588, 686, 1029, 1176, 1372, 2058, 2401, 2744, 4116, 4802, 7203, 8232, 9604, 14406, 19208, 28812, 57624. Its prime factorization can be written as 2^3 × 3 × 7^4. 57624 is classified as a abundant number based on the sum of its proper divisors. In computer science, 57624 is represented as 1110000100011000 in binary and E118 in hexadecimal.
